The Gardens of Riverside offers a range of accommodation options with monthly costs that reflect the premium services and amenities provided. For a semi-private room, residents can expect to pay $4,745, which is notably higher than Riverside County's average of $2,844 and California's overall average of $3,333. Similarly, for studio apartments at The Gardens, the monthly fee stands at $5,695 - significantly above both the county's average rate of $3,559 and the state's average of $4,145. These figures suggest that while The Gardens of Riverside may be on the pricier side compared to local and state benchmarks, its pricing likely correlates with enhanced care options and a supportive living environment tailored to residents' needs.

The Gardens of Riverside is best suited for families seeking memory-care focused support in a warm, home-like setting where staff engagement, family communication, and a cuidando culture are primary. The campus offers bungalow-style living quarters, a welcoming courtyard, and on-site elements like a small farm and ongoing activities that create daily variety without a sterile, hospital feel. It suits seniors with dementia or Alzheimer's who respond to a structured, social environment and who benefit from regular updates and visible staff involvement. For families prioritizing affordability alongside quality care, and those who want a community that treats residents like part of a extended family, this is a compelling option in Riverside.
Those who may want to consider alternatives include families confronting persistent safety or staffing concerns, or those whose loved one requires heavy, around-the-clock medical oversight. Several reviews flag understaffing and delayed responses during high-demand times, with worries about supervision and timely assistance. If a resident has frequent wandering, falls, or escalating medical needs that demand constant RN presence, other communities with higher nurse-to-resident ratios and more formal escalation protocols may be a better match. Also, if a care plan hinges on rapid incident resolution or if leadership stability is a priority, it pays to compare options before committing.
The strongest positives center on the staff's warmth, reliability, and continuity of care. Executive leadership - especially the district's praised director - emerges as a stabilizing force, with families noting clear communication, timely updates, and personalized attention. Caregivers and med-techs are described as genuinely caring, capable, and responsive, and the overall culture emphasizes treating residents like members of a family. The programming is robust: regular activities, social events, music, and excursions help residents stay engaged, while the grounds and on-site amenities create a comfortable, almost residential atmosphere. For families weighing cost against care quality, the facility's willingness to work with Medi-Cal and thePACE program adds a practical affordability layer, broadening access to a well-regarded memory-care environment.
On the other side, the principal drawbacks revolve around staffing intensity and safety. Multiple accounts describe periods when residents waited for assistance due to lunch breaks or other duties, and several reviews recount incidents or near-misses where a delayed response affected well-being. Reports of a head injury followed by a slow hospital transfer, along with occasional concerns about monitoring and supervision, temper the otherwise favorable impression. A handful of posts also question leadership dynamics, suggesting that not all administrators meet every family's expectations, which can color the overall confidence in the community's governance.
Yet the pros substantially offset the cons for families who can prioritize a proactive care culture and a transparent, caring approach to memory care. When staff leadership is strong and responsive, families feel informed and connected, and residents benefit from predictable routines, meaningful activities, and timely medication management. The campus design - homey apartments, safe exits, inviting outdoor spaces, and accessible bathrooms - supports independence within a secure frame. The sense that frontline staff will go the extra mile to accommodate dietary needs, celebrations, or personalized routines remains a meaningful counterbalance to occasional staffing gaps, especially for families seeking dignity and warmth in every interaction.
For families evaluating whether to place a loved one here, a guided decision path centers on practical checks and lived experiences. Schedule a thorough tour focused on current staffing patterns during peak hours, observe how staff interact with residents, and ask for written care plans and incident logs. Speak with multiple staff members, including the director, activities coordinator, and front-line caregivers, to gauge consistency and responsiveness. Verify that the resident's medical needs align with the facility's capabilities and confirm how the Medi-Cal/PACE arrangements would apply. If a home-like, community-driven environment with strong leadership and engaging activities is the priority, The Gardens of Riverside stands out as a sound choice - provided one accepts that caregiver ratios and safety vigilance must be actively monitored over time.

The transition from assisted living to skilled nursing care is often prompted by complex medical needs that assisted living cannot meet, with key indicators including frequent health declines, increased falls, severe memory issues, and caregiver burnout. Families should recognize these signs early to discuss options with healthcare providers and prepare for the emotional and logistical aspects of moving to a facility that offers comprehensive medical support.
Nourishing the Mind: Essential Dietary Approaches for Dementia
Dementia is characterized by cognitive decline, with nutrition playing a vital role in brain health; while no specific diet can prevent or reverse it, a nutrient-dense diet rich in antioxidants and healthy fats may support cognitive function. The MIND diet, which emphasizes beneficial foods and limits processed items, along with proper hydration and individualized meal strategies, can enhance the well-being of dementia patients.
Understanding Dementia Behaviors: Practical Insights and Strategies for Caregivers
Dementia affects memory and cognitive function in older adults, presenting challenges for caregivers due to behavioral changes such as confusion and mood swings. Compassionate, person-centered care that considers individual history and preferences, along with effective communication and environmental modifications, is essential for supporting both patients and their caregivers.
